one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the Internet through which a protracted URL might be transformed right into a shorter, more workable variety. This shortened URL redirects to the first extensive URL when frequented.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-recognized sam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social websites plat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ts designed it challenging to share prolonged URLs.

Further than social websites, URL shorteners are valuable in internet marketing campaigns, emails, and printed media in which prolonged URLs is often cumbersome.

two. Main Elements of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ically is made up of the next parts:

Net Interface: This can be the entrance-close aspect wherever people can enter their extensive URLs and acquire shortened variations. It may be a simple form over a web page.
Database: A database is necessary to retailer the mapping among the first extensive URL and also the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This is actually the backend logic that will take the limited URL and redirects the consumer for the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ic will likely be executed in the internet server or an application layer.
API: Many URL shorteners provide an API to make sure that 3rd-occasion ap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original very long URLs.
three. Planning the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ing an extended URL into a brief one particular. Numerous strategies is usually utilized, such as:

Hashing: The lengthy URL is usually hashed into a fixed-dimension string, which serves as being the shorter URL. Nonetheless, hash collisions (diverse URLs leading to the identical h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one common method is to employ Base62 encoding (which employs 62 people: 0-9,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ry from the database. This method makes certain that the short URL is as small as feasible.
Random String Era: A further approach is always to make a random string of a fixed length (e.g., six characters) and Test if it’s currently in use during the database. If not, it’s assigned to the lengthy URL.
4. Databases Management
The databases schema for a URL shortener is usually clear-cut, with two primary fields:

ID: A novel identifier for each URL entry.
Lengthy UR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Shorter URL/Slug: The small Edition from the URL, normally saved as a singular string.
As well as these, you may want to store metadata including the generation date, expiration day, and the amount of times the quick URL has been accessed.

5. Managing Redirection
Redirection can be a critical Section of the URL shortener's Procedure. Each time a person clicks on a short URL, the provider ought to rapidly retrieve the first URL in the databases and redirect the consumer making use of an HTTP 301 (long-lasting red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) standing code.

Efficiency is essential listed here, as the procedure needs to be nearly instantaneous. Tactics like databases indexing and caching (e.g., utilizing Redis or Memcached) is often employed to speed up the retrieval course of action.

6. Safety Things to consider
Security is a major wor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ener may be abused to unfold destructive one-way links. Implementing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-social gathering stability solutions to check URLs ahead of shortening them can mitigate this possibility.
Spam Avoidance: Rate limiting and CAPTCHA can avoid abuse by spammers looking to crank out Many short UR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it might need to deal with an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out various servers to take care of superior h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that could sc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ual worries like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inct providers to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ners normally present analytics to trace how often a brief URL is clicked, wherever the website traffic is coming from, together with other valuable metrics. This demands logging each red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
